Blue and green gold – Water and Agriculture: From a toxic relationship to a virtuous circle
Description
Water inequalities and extreme weather events are putting food security and peace at high risk. These tensions, already present, are only going to increase with a changing climate. Water and the access to it, is seen as the main reason for conflicts in the future. As a major consumer of water, agriculture is deeply implicated in this concern and should therefore be involved in the elaboration of solutions regarding water stress response. This article briefly explores the means of measurement and the possibilities that need to be considered to face the challenges of tomorrow. How can agriculture be more than a mere receiver of solutions to continue functioning, but an active part of the solution process itself?
